Great Smoky Mountains National Park

See why 'The Smokies' are America's most visited national park.

GSMRAlso, while you're visiting the park, why not stop by the Great Smoky Mountains Railroad? Step onboard for train adventures as it takes you through a remote corner of Western North Carolina with a ghostly tunnel, a high breathtaking trestle and fugitive wreck site. GSMR offers a variety of trips including the Nantahala Gorge & Tuckasegee River Excursions, First Class service, rafting combinations and special events!
